A Python implementation of the **Quantile Autoregression Unit Root Test** proposed by Koenker & Xiao (2004).

## Overview

This package implements the quantile autoregression-based unit root test, which provides:

- **Robust inference** under non-Gaussian disturbances (heavy-tailed distributions)
- **Asymmetric dynamics detection** - the ability to detect different persistence patterns at different quantiles
- **Power gains** over conventional ADF tests with non-normal errors
- **Publication-ready output** and visualization tools

## Model Specifications

The test supports two model specifications:

| Model | Description | Default |
|-------|-------------|---------|
| `'c'` | Constant only | ✓ (Koenker & Xiao default) |
| `'ct'` | Constant and linear trend | |

## Test Statistics

The package computes:

1. **t-statistic** `tₙ(τ)`: The quantile regression counterpart of the ADF t-ratio
2. **Coefficient statistic** `Uₙ(τ) = n(ρ̂₁(τ) - 1)`: Coefficient-based test
3. **QKS statistics**: Kolmogorov-Smirnov type tests over quantile range
4. **QCM statistics**: Cramér-von Mises type tests over quantile range

## Critical Values

Critical values are based on Hansen (1995), which tabulates critical values for the CADF test. The limiting distribution of the QADF test is:

```
tₙ(τ) → δ(∫₀¹ W̄₁²)^{-1/2} ∫₀¹ W̄₁dW₁ + √(1-δ²)N(0,1)
```

This is a mixture of the Dickey-Fuller distribution and the standard normal, with weights determined by δ (the long-run correlation coefficient).
